E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
半包粘包
TCP 协议十大相关特性总结
十大核心特性1.确认应答2.超时重传3.连接管理(三次握手,四次挥手)三次握手四次挥手4.滑动窗口情况一:接收方的ACK丢失情况二:发送方的数据包丢失5.流量控制6.拥塞控制7.延迟应答8.捎带应答9.字节流
粘包
问题
²º¹⁷旧人不必等
·
2023-08-10 13:17
JavaEE
网络编程
tcp/ip
网络协议
网络
Netty学习笔记四-序列化
上一节学习了Netty的TCP拆包
粘包
问题的解决之道,今天学习Netty的序列化。什么是序列化引入百科:序列化(Serialization)是将对象的状态信息转换为可以存储或传输的形式的过程。
无聪帅
·
2023-08-10 13:53
23.Netty源码之内置解码器
highlight:arduino-lightNetty内置的解码器在前两节课我们介绍了TCP拆包/
粘包
的问题,以及如何使用Netty实现自定义协议的编解码。
然而,然而
·
2023-08-10 06:51
java
网络
开发语言
TCP和UDP
三次握手和四次挥手TCP维护可靠的通信方式拥塞控制滑动窗口的原理什么是
粘包
以及
粘包
的原因
粘包
的处理方式TCP和UDP使用场景TCP和UDP是什么?
txinyu的博客
·
2023-08-08 10:22
tcp/ip
udp
网络协议
Tcp的
粘包
和
半包
问题及解决方案
目录
粘包
:
半包
:应用进程如何解读字节流?如何解决
粘包
和
半包
问题?
陈岂几真幸运
·
2023-08-07 19:46
计算机网络
c++
linux
开发语言
C++解决TCP
粘包
目录TCP
粘包
问题TCP客户端TCP服务端源码测试TCP
粘包
问题TCP是面向连接的,面向流的可靠性传输。
夏天匆匆2过
·
2023-08-06 23:24
C/C++
c++
tcp/ip
spring
linux
c语言
网络
如何解决TCP
粘包
问题?(Netty二)
在TCP
粘包
/拆包的问题如何解决?服务端在启动流程是什么样的?连接服务流程是什么?一编解码器1.1什么叫编解码器在网络传输的过程中,数据都是以字节流的方式进行传递。
想回家种地的程序员
·
2023-08-06 16:45
2019-10-29
不管你选
半包
、套餐、还是选全案整装的装修模式...不花一分冤枉钱实现家装蓝图。
西安新老房装修设计李萌
·
2023-08-06 14:59
【Linux 网络】 传输层协议之TCP协议 && TCP的三次握手和四次挥手
序号与确认序号TCP协议段——窗口大小TCP协议段——六个标志位确认应答机制(ACK)超时重传机制连接管理机制TCP的三次握手四次挥手TCP三次握手四次挥手总结图滑动窗口流量控制拥塞控制延迟应答捎带应答面向字节流
粘包
问题
有心栽花无心插柳
·
2023-08-06 05:44
Linux
网络
linux
tcp/ip
如何选择适合自己的装修公司?准备装修的朋友一定要看
152642h9l96ikseykototo.jpg从装修方式上分,装修基本分为三种:全包、
半包
和清包。
石头哥说装修
·
2023-08-06 05:17
Netty
粘包
半包
什么是TCP
粘包
半包
?假设客户端分别发送了两个数据包D1和D2给服务端,由于服务端一次读取到的字节数是不确定的,故可能存在以下4种情况。
孤单品尝寂寞
·
2023-08-06 05:07
分布式框架
网络
iOS 整理-网络篇
3、Https的连接建立过程4、三次握手和四次挥手5、TCP和UDP的优缺点6、Cookie和Session的区别7、Socket的原理和连接过程8、iOSSocket封包、
粘包
、拆包处理网络七层协议应用层
凉秋落尘
·
2023-08-05 23:42
什么是
粘包
?
TCP/IP协议簇建立了互联网中通信协议的概念模型,该协议簇中的两个主要协议就是TCP和IP协议。TCP/IP协议簇中的TCP协议能够保证数据段(Segment)的可靠性和顺序,有了可靠的传输层协议之后,应用层协议就可以直接使用TCP协议传输数据,不在需要关心数据段的丢失和重复问题。图1-TCP协议与应用层协议IP协议解决了数据包(Packet)的路由和传输,上层的TCP协议不再关注路由和寻址,那
想名真难
·
2023-08-05 19:28
网络相关
生日
尽管我早已结婚生子,但母亲的爱仍然还是“
半包
围式”,但凡做点好吃的,总是想着我们,好像生怕我们饿着。第二天中午,还不到12点,母亲又是接连几个电话催促。我带着女儿逛完街,回到父母住处,桌上已
淡墨拒加
·
2023-08-05 18:32
每次一到这个时候,就恨自己没有能力做一个全职妈妈
我在公司上班又不能立马回去,只能干着急的躲到更衣室去视频回家,哄着吃了
半包
去火的药,后来滴眼睛就死活不滴了。我心里急的半死,又不能说回家就回家,这就是职场妈妈的身不由己。
小龙虾爱吃虾
·
2023-08-05 16:53
2021年9月14日 星期二 晴(150)
今天打扫卫生的时候,浇花浇多了,水流出来了,她用了
半包
纸才擦干的!趁机问她,检查别人的卫生是不是要先把自己的卫生打扫干净?以后要把自己的课桌,书包打扫干净、收拾好?
嘻嘻宁宁的哆啦A梦
·
2023-08-05 15:31
TCP & Socket 基础知识点(实例是以Java进行演示)
协议的主要特点1.3TCP的可靠性原理1.4报文段1.4.1端口1.4.2seq序号1.4.3ack确认号1.4.4数据偏移1.4.5保留1.4.6控制位1.4.7窗口1.4.8校验和1.4.9紧急指针1.5
粘包
与拆包
十月旧城
·
2023-08-05 07:02
TCP/IP
tcp/ip
网络
网络基础问题
介绍TCP滑动窗口,拥塞控制TCP
粘包
原因及解决办法(了解即可)TCP与UDP的区别?TCP与UDP报文格式?
青鱼入云
·
2023-08-04 15:33
Java面试
计算机网络
网络
面试
高性能网络框架笔记
目录TCP
粘包
、分包惊群断开连接,TCP怎么检测的?大量的closewait,如何解?
在三年之后
·
2023-08-04 11:33
C++开发后端基础知识
网络
笔记
网络相关
什么是
粘包
以及怎么解决只有TCP有
粘包
现象,UDP永远不会
粘包
,因为TCP是基于数据流的协议,而UDP是基于数据报的协议image.png发送端可以是一K一K地发送数据,而接收端的应用程序可以两K两K地提走数据
Devil萝
·
2023-08-03 16:57
10-10上网课第三天
10个字全部出示在田字格里,我说出了左右结构、独体字、
半包
围的字都有哪些,这个问题可以让学生找完,我来小结,而不是我直接讲给他们。我代替学生讲,学生到头来什么也没有记住。
燕儿飞啊飞
·
2023-08-03 15:01
QT-C++多线程TCP客户端(心跳包、自动消息接收发送处理,
粘包
处理)
QT-C++多线程TCP客户端前言1.效果预览2.核心程序3.程序下载前言将接收消息和发送消息分别用不同线程处理,支持服务器掉线客户端重新连接机制,内置自动消息发送和接收处理方式,内置心跳包发送。提示:以下是本篇文章正文内容,下面案例可供参考1.效果预览2.核心程序代码如下://发送线程DWORDWINAPIcSocketClient::sendCmdDataThread(LPVOIDlpPara
进击的大海贼
·
2023-08-03 10:04
Qt
C++
qt
c++
计算机网络为何需要分层架构?
但是,就在前几天出了一篇TCP
粘包
问题的文章(TCP
粘包
,难道说这是一个伪命题???),反映不错。本来计划计算机网络文章慢慢的出,现在看来必须的加快速度了。
龙跃十二
·
2023-08-03 00:33
Socket Java I/O Socket I/O
1、深入分析JavaI/O的工作机制2、Socket高性能IO模型浅析3、Socket/TCP
粘包
、多包和少包,断包4、JAVA中BIO,NIO,AIO的理解5、使用事件驱动模型实现高效稳定的网络服务器程序
iQuester
·
2023-08-02 23:47
Java
socket
java
io
Server - 网络
粘包
原因
网络
粘包
是指发送方发送的数据被接收方一次性接收的现象,导致接收方无法正确解析数据的边界。
莫忘输赢
·
2023-08-02 10:48
网络
php
开发语言
Linux 网络基础(二)---传输层
协议段格式确认应答(ACK)机制超时重传机制连接管理机制TIME_WAIT解决TIME_WAIT状态引起的bind失败的方法理解CLOSE_WAIT状态滑动窗口流量控制拥塞控制延迟应答捎带应答面向字节流
粘包
问
qnbk
·
2023-08-02 00:20
Linux
网络
linux
udp
tcp
【linux--->传输层协议】
缓冲区四、TCP协议1.格式2.4位的数据偏移3.确认应答机制4.序号与确认序号5.16位窗口6.标志位7.超时重传8.三次握手9.四次挥手10.滑动窗口11.拥塞控制12.延迟应答13.面向字节流14.
粘包
问题
kk1125778230
·
2023-08-02 00:46
linux
运维
服务器
C#下利用封包、拆包原理解决Socket
粘包
、
半包
问题(新手篇)
一般来说,教你C#下Socket编程的老师,很少会教你如何解决Socket
粘包
、
半包
问题。更甚至,某些师德有问题的老师,根本就没跟你说过Socket的
粘包
、
半包
问题是什么玩意儿。
某人在
·
2023-08-01 22:13
NO樱花!NO寿司!|河风寿司店
项目地址:《合肥市漫乐城店》施工单位:合肥行知堂工作室工程造价:3.5万
半包
设计师:张大伟河风寿司店前身主做线上(外卖)餐厅是一家日式料理餐厅,风格偏向家庭日常休闲。
行知堂设计
·
2023-08-01 19:31
从0到1开发go-tcp框架【2-实现Message模块、解决TCP
粘包
问题、实现多路由机制】
从0到1开发go-tcp框架【2-实现Message模块、解决TCP
粘包
问题、实现多路由机制】1实现\封装Message模块zinx/ziface/imessage.gopackagezifacetypeIMessageinterface
NPE~
·
2023-08-01 12:45
框架
go
golang
tcp/ip
开发语言
框架开发
教程
实战进阶
换种方式大不同
我经常跟学生们笑谈我们八一班最适合蒸桑拿,顶楼上面烤,最西边下午半天烤,前面还有堵墙,两面不通风,简直是密不透风,在这间教室上课了几年,汗水挥洒了不少,尤其是晚自习擦的汗可以用
半包
纸巾。
w王艳萍
·
2023-08-01 09:17
【计算机网络】传输层协议 -- TCP协议
发送缓冲区与接收缓冲区3.3窗口大小3.4六个标志位4.确认应答机制5.超时重传机制6.连接管理机制6.1三次握手6.2四次挥手7.流量控制8.滑动窗口9.拥塞控制10.延迟应答11.捎带应答12.面向字节流13.
粘包
问题
zzu_ljk
·
2023-08-01 06:16
计算机网络
tcp/ip
网络协议
网络
如何解决
粘包
半包
粘包
与
半包
粘包
现象服务端代码publicclassHelloWorldServer{staticfinalLoggerlog=LoggerFactory.getLogger(HelloWorldServer.class
软件开发随心记
·
2023-07-31 22:29
笔记
java
2022-12-27
走出卧室,发现已经准备好了想吃的食料:两个鸡蛋、一袋里脊、还有
半包
馄饨。孩子已经自己准备好煮馄饨了,安排我给准备煎锅,看TA大都准备好了,心里稍有安慰,已经开始自己做事了,这也挺好的。
嘉英索菲
·
2023-07-31 11:50
【计网】一起聊聊TCP的
粘包
拆包问题吧
文章目录1、介绍2、为什么会出现
粘包
/拆包问题2.1、TCP协议2.2、
粘包
问题2.3、拆包问题3、
粘包
/拆包场景4、解决方案4.1、固定长度的数据包4.2、特殊字符或标记4.3、消息头5、为什么UDP
陈宝子
·
2023-07-31 03:19
计算机网络
tcp/ip
网络
网络协议
愤怒的宝宝
“宝宝,别吃薯片了,你都吃了大
半包
了,太热气了”“我就爱吃,怎么啦!”“买薯片前你不是答应爸爸每天只吃一点点吗”“我自己的钱买的,爱怎么吃就怎么吃,不用你们管!”
留白之路
·
2023-07-30 21:37
【Linux】TCP协议
那段时光是付出了很多努力却得不到结果的日子,我们把它叫做扎根目录TCP协议TCP协议段格式确认应答机制窗口大小六个标记位连接管理机制三次握手四次挥手超时重传流量控制滑动窗口拥塞控制延迟应答捎带应答面向字节流
粘包
问题
阿亮joy.
·
2023-07-30 11:10
学会Linux
网络
TCP协议
Linux
茶
哪怕是条件有限,无法找到合适的茶具,拣茶叶小
半包
,往透明的玻璃杯里一扔,开水一注,热气腾腾,白烟直冒。而后,便是淡淡的茶香溢满鼻间。
头枕草地
·
2023-07-30 08:05
花41w装修的135㎡三室两厅,只为让家人住得更舒适
户型:三室两厅■面积:135平■风格:简约北欧风格■
半包
:15万■全部:41万(包含电器、全部软装配饰等)原始户型图▼花41w装修的135㎡三室两厅,只为让家人住得更舒适平面改造后布置图▼花41w装修的
九博尚居软装设计
·
2023-07-30 02:20
52、马蜂(静静的汉江节选)
房子被浩浩汤汤的流水
半包
围着,像个半岛。水渠坎上,长满了茂盛的李子树。由于屋子前面没有人家遮挡,李子树享受着充分的阳光照耀,吮吸着从秦岭山上流下的甘泉,长势特别得好。
苗一之石
·
2023-07-29 17:24
粘包
处理的方式
为什么出现
粘包
:发送端在发送的时候由于Nagel算法的存在会将字节数较小的数据整合到一起发送,导致
粘包
;接收端不知道发送端数据的长度,导致接收时无法区分数据;
粘包
处理的方式:通过在数据前面加上报头,通知接收发数据的结构
M_qsqsqsq
·
2023-07-29 09:37
计算机网络
计算机网络
呼市城市人家装饰---74平米复式现代案例
呼和浩特城市人家是包工包料的,也就是材料费和人工费都包含了,这样属于
半包
模式呼市城市人家装饰水电类:水电气布线、下水改造、材料包含了强弱电线、水管、电管、穿线管。呼市城市
阿荣_4204
·
2023-07-28 13:11
139平北欧现代混搭风,粉粉的女儿房美呆了!
面积:建筑面积139方,实用面积128方房屋类型:旧房改造户型:三室一厅一厨二卫总花费:44w(包含所有硬软装产品和部分日用品)装修模式:
半包
12w(全屋木地板,柜子只做了客厅)风格:混搭
ac96646f1409
·
2023-07-28 11:10
为什么大部分人选择了自己装修?这是我听过最走心的答案
通过简短的周边市场调查,才意外的发现原来身边很多的朋友都是选择的
半包
或者自装,设计师自己找!施工队自己找!主材自己买!更有甚者在网上下单购买木地板,回家后老公和公公一起铺贴。
扫地僧施工
·
2023-07-28 11:38
TCP/IP的分包
粘包
TCP/IP的分包
粘包
分包
粘包
介绍导致分包
粘包
的原因导致TCP
粘包
的原因:导致TCP分包的原因:避免分包
粘包
的措施分包
粘包
介绍因为TCP为了减少额外开销,采取的是流式传输,所以接收端在一次接收的时候有可能一次接收多个包
lliuhao--
·
2023-07-28 10:59
计算机网络
tcp/ip
网络
网络协议
深度挖掘《TCP与UDP》
流量控制拥塞控制延时等待捎带应答面向字节流---
粘包
王小花花花!
·
2023-07-26 22:16
tcp/ip
udp
网络
Netty全面解读-----入门篇
Netty是一个异步(非异步IO)的、基于事件驱动的网络应用框架,用于快速开发可维护、高性能的网络服务器和客户端Netty的优势NettyvsNIO,工作量大,bug多需要自己构建协议解决TCP传输问题,如
粘包
方渐鸿
·
2023-07-25 19:57
NIO
java
网络协议
网络
网络编程八股文
文章目录tcp
粘包
问题?BIO,NIO,AIO是什么?零拷贝是什么?浏览器发出一个请求到收到响应的具体步骤?select,poll,epoll区别是什么?https是如何保证安全传输的?
孙仲谋111
·
2023-07-25 10:06
网络编程
网络
家乡的那条河
一条小河蜿蜒曲折的把我们村
半包
围了。这条小河是我们村的标志物之一,也是我们村夏天男人们的浴池,也承载了我整个童年的回忆。
伊香儿
·
2023-07-24 20:52
阿里Java高级架构面试:熟悉TCP
粘包
、拆包?
一、TCP
粘包
、拆包图解假设客户端分别发送了两个数据包D1和D2给服务端,由于服务端一次读取到字节数是不确定的,故可能存在以下四种情况:服务端分两次读取到了两个独立的数据包,分别是D1和D2,没有
粘包
和拆包服务端一次接受到了两个数据包
大V认证鸠摩智
·
2023-07-23 14:23
上一页
6
7
8
9
10
11
12
13
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他